Who Were the Jedi Younglings?
The Jedi Younglings, or Jedi Initiates, were the youngest members of the Jedi Order — Force-sensitive children discovered across the galaxy and brought to the Jedi Temple on Coruscant for training. Divided into clans, each of about twenty members, they studied the Force, lightsaber fundamentals, and Jedi traditions under the guidance of the Masters.
From the earliest age, they learned discipline, meditation, and the importance of balance — key lessons before earning the rank of Padawan. The Jedi valued potential over species, seeing in every being a chance to serve the Force.
The Gathering: The Heart of Every Jedi
Each youngling eventually faced The Gathering — a sacred journey to Ilum, a planet rich in kyber crystals. This ritual tested not just their skill but their connection to the Force and courage to face inner fears. Guided by Masters and overseen by Professor Huyang, the younglings forged their first lightsabers — a moment of profound transformation.
The Fall: When Hope Met the Dark Side
The tragedy of Order 66 shattered the dreams of many. When Anakin Skywalker turned into Darth Vader, he stormed the Jedi Temple under the orders of Darth Sidious — slaughtering the very children who once looked up to him. Only a few, like Grogu and Reva (The Third Sister), survived.

FAQs: Jedi Younglings Explained
Who were the Jedi Younglings?
They were Force-sensitive children selected by the Jedi Order and trained at the Temple on Coruscant to become future Jedi Knights.
Did Grogu survive Order 66?
Yes, Grogu was one of the younglings rescued by Jedi Master Kelleran Beq during the fall of the Temple.
How many younglings did Anakin kill?
The exact number is unknown, but records suggest most younglings inside the Temple were slain during his assault.
Did any youngling escape?
Yes — Grogu and Reva (the Third Sister) are known survivors, each taking different paths after the purge.
What did the Gathering teach the younglings?
It taught them courage, patience, and harmony with the Force as they sought their kyber crystals on Ilum.
